Real Estate Portfolio Diversity: A Smart Investment Method

Branching out a realty portfolio is necessary for minimizing risk, taking full advantage of returns, and ensuring long-term financial stability. By spreading investments across different home kinds, areas, and market fields, capitalists can minimize financial fluctuations and create a resistant profile.

Why Expand Your Real Estate Portfolio?

Diversification offers a number of crucial advantages:

Threat Decrease-- Minimizes direct exposure to downturns in details markets or property kinds.

Consistent Cash Flow-- A mix of property, industrial, and rental buildings ensures constant earnings.

Capital Admiration-- Investing in several areas can bring about greater residential or commercial property value development over time.

Market Stability-- A diversified profile assists hold up against economic changes and realty cycles.

Better Financial Investment Opportunities-- Accessibility to numerous building types enables more critical asset allotment.

Ways to Diversify a Realty Portfolio

1. Buy Different Residential Or Commercial Property Types

Residential Features: Single-family homes, multi-family homes, apartments.

Commercial Residences: Office spaces, retailers, industrial structures.

Getaway Leasings: Temporary rental properties in tourist hotspots.

Mixed-Use Developments: Integrating property, business, and workplace.

2. Broaden Across Different Locations

Urban Markets: High need and solid recognition potential.

Suburbs: Budget friendly financial investment alternatives with growing need.

Emerging Markets: Fast-growing cities with high return potential.

3. Think About Real Estate Investment Company (REITs).

Public REITs: Trade on stock market, supplying liquidity.

Personal REITs: Usually provide greater returns but call for longer holding durations.

Sector-Specific REITs: Focus on niche markets like healthcare, friendliness, or industrial properties.

4. Expand Through Realty Crowdfunding.

Permits investors to merge funds and accessibility high-value residential or commercial properties.

Gives lower entrance prices compared to standard real estate investing.

5. Discover Property Development and Flipping.

Advancement: Purchasing brand-new construction or redevelopment projects.

Turning: Buying undervalued homes, refurbishing, and costing revenue.

Secret Elements to Think About When Branching out.

Market Patterns: Assess need, rental prices, and economic indications.

Building Administration: Consider self-management or working with a expert residential or commercial property supervisor.

Funding Options: Explore mortgages, partnerships, and crowdfunding platforms.

Legal & Tax Implications: Understand zoning laws, real estate tax, and investment frameworks.

Typical Errors to Prevent in Realty Diversification.

Over-Concentration in One Market: Spread financial investments across numerous areas to reduce danger.

Ignoring Capital Analysis: Ensure homes generate positive rental income.

Absence of Due Diligence: Research neighborhood market problems before investing.

Falling Short to Branch Out Home Types: A healthy portfolio includes numerous possession classes.


Property portfolio diversity is a effective technique for constructing riches, decreasing risk, and attaining financial stability. By purchasing various home kinds, locations, and investment structures, financiers can produce a resistant and lucrative realty profile.
